History

The School of Aqua was initiated in the mid-1980s. Originally, it was exclusively dedicated to research and extension activities. However, in 1990, the first course was offered on an experimental basis. By 1992, an undergraduate minor in Aquaculture and Aquatic Sciences was first available, and in 1999 the Council on Post-Secondary Education approved KSU to offer a Master of Science Degree in Aquaculture and Aquatic Sciences.

Until the establishment of the College of Agriculture, Health, and Natural Resources, the School of Aquaculture and Aquatic Sciences was the only program at KSU that addressed all three of the traditional Land Grant university roles: research, teaching, and extension. The School has class offerings over the full spectrum of aquaculture, including reproduction, nutrition, water quality, physiology, production systems, economics and marketing, and fish disease. The School also offers online classes at both the undergraduate and graduate levels.

Dr. Ray runs a productive research program that focuses on areas such as recirculating aquaculture systems development and management, water quality dynamics, water filtration technologies, denitrification, functional microbial ecology, brackish-water aquaponics, inland production of marine species, artificial seawater formulation, consumer perception and acceptance of seafood products, STEM education for a variety of student age groups, and farmer risk and needs assessment. He teaches the courses Water Quality Management, Water Quality Management Laboratory, and Recirculating Aquaculture. Dr. Ray works primarily with marine shrimp and marine fish so that farmers in inland locations can produce high-quality, sustainable, fresh seafood near consumer markets.

Dr. Semmens supports research  and teaching to address production and marketing issues facing the aquaculture industry relevant to small farms in the state of Kentucky and the region.  His research has focused on design and management of floating raceways, induced spawning and production of largemouth bass, holding systems for marketing food fish, integrating aquaculture and water reuse for decommissioned wastewater treatment facilities, aquaponics, and culture of paddlefish. He has developed curriculum for entry level undergraduate course, implementing both dual credit and online sections. He teaches Fish Morphology/ Physiology (AQU 412, 512), Fisheries for an Educated Consumer (AQU 201), Survey of Production Methods (AQU 451/551), and co-teaches Fish Reproduction Lab (AQU 428,528).

Noel D. Novelo, Ph.D., is of Yucatecan Maya and Spanish (Mestizo) descent. He is from Belize, but he currently lives in Kentucky and works as an Assistant Professor in Aquaculture Genetics and Extension in the School of Aquaculture and Aquatic Sciences at Âé¶¹Ö±²¥ (KSU). He serves as President-Elect of the Kentucky Academy of Science 2023 Governing Board (Board term 2022-2025), and as Faculty Advisor to the KSU United States Aquaculture Society Student Subunit. His academic training includes Multi-Cultural English Literature, Natural Resource Management, Public Administration, Aquaculture and Aquatic Sciences, and Wildlife and Fisheries Science. He has 20 years of experience in reproduction, culture, and genetics of farmed Aquatic species, specializing in Ornamental (Koi) Carp, Channel Catfish, and Nile Tilapia. His program of work seeks to expand agricultural production by securing and diversifying food production, developing and improving on Aquatic genetic resources, and creating resources based on assistive reproductive technologies such as ultrasound imaging and cryopreservation to advance Kentucky and U.S. aquaculture production, and to expand human health and business opportunities for minority and limited-resource farmers and U.S. consumers. He seeks to establish and expand collaborative efforts within the USA, and internationally— with Central America, the Caribbean, and other global regions.

Dr. Durborow directs the KSU Fish Disease Diagnostic Laboratory that includes a mobile responsive clinical fish health database. Dr. Durborow performs and directs research in the KSU College of Agriculture, Health, and Natural Resources, including projects involving the KSU FDDL, treatment efficacy, medicated feed accessibility, increasing shelf life of processed fish, and occupational safety and health for aquaculturists and Gulf Coast seafood workers. Dr. Durborow teaches Fish Diseases (online and on campus) and Fish Diseases Laboratory (on campus) to undergraduate and graduate students.

Dr. Waldemar Rossi leads the Aquaculture Nutrition research program, which focuses on the nutritional optimization of feeds for finfish and crustacean species of commercial relevance in aquaculture. Primary research interests include raw material evaluations, determination of nutritional requirements, testing of feed additives, and feed formulation. Within the M.S. in Aquaculture and Aquatic Sciences Program, Dr. Rossi teaches Fish Nutrition, advises graduate and undergraduate students, and provides technical support to stakeholders in aquaculture nutrition-related areas.

Dr. Erbland has 25 years of experience in aquaculture and aquatic ecology working across many sectors including regulation, restoration, research, education and industry. He is especially interested in research and development of systems and species to produce sustainable seafood with minimal environmental footprint. He has previously worked with land based, Recirculating Aquaculture Systems (RAS), Integrated Multi-Trophic Aquaculture (IMTA), shellfish aquaculture, microalgae production and sustainable feed production. Dr. Erbland teaches the Principles of Aquaculture (AQU 422/522) and Survey of Production Methods (AQU 451/551) courses.

Dr. Dayan A. Perera is an Assistant Professor of Pond Management and Aquaculture Extension in the School of Aquaculture and Aquatic Sciences at Âé¶¹Ö±²¥. He leads the University's statewide Extension program in pond management and aquaculture, providing science-based education and technical assistance to producers, landowners, Extension agents, natural resource professionals, and the general public throughout Kentucky. His program is dedicated to improving the health, productivity, and sustainability of Kentucky's thousands of private ponds while supporting the continued growth and economic development of the Commonwealth's aquaculture industry.

Dr. Perera's Extension and applied research program focuses on the management of ponds used for aquaculture, recreational fisheries, and other multiple-use purposes. His areas of expertise include pond water quality, aquatic weed identification and management, fish health, pond ecology, aquatic habitat improvement, and sustainable aquaculture production. He works closely with clientele across Kentucky through on-site consultations, diagnostic services, educational workshops, field demonstrations, Extension publications, and producer training programs that promote science-based management practices and long-term stewardship of aquatic resources.

Originally from Sri Lanka, Dr. Perera has more than 20 years of experience in aquaculture research, teaching, and Extension. Prior to joining Âé¶¹Ö±²¥, he served as an Assistant Professor and Extension Specialist at the University of Arkansas at Pine Bluff, where he developed nationally recognized Extension programming and conducted applied research in aquaculture production systems. His research and professional collaborations have taken him throughout the United States and internationally, including projects in Vietnam, the Philippines, and the Canary Islands.

Dr. Perera teaches undergraduate and graduate courses in aquaculture and aquatic sciences while mentoring the next generation of aquatic resource professionals. His research integrates applied science with Extension outreach and focuses on developing practical, science-based solutions that improve pond management, enhance aquaculture production, and strengthen aquatic resource stewardship. Through collaborative research and stakeholder engagement, his goal is to improve the sustainability, productivity, and profitability of aquaculture and private pond management throughout Kentucky.
